Internationally-recognized mathematician to speak at University of Northern Iowa Monday (Nov. 20)
Article Summary:
Ephim Zel'manov is an expert in the theory of Jordan algebras, and recently surprised the international mathematics community by solving the so called "restricted Burnside problem," which resulted from a group of algebraic problems posed in 1902.
